"use strict"; Object.defineProperty(exports, "__esModule", { value: true }); exports.default = hashBuffer; exports.fnv = fnv; exports.djb = djb; exports.murmur3 = murmur3; /** * Hash a Buffer or Uint8Array and return the value. */ function hashBuffer(input) { let hash = 0; const length = input.length; for (let i = 0; i < length; i++) { hash = (hash << 5) - hash + input[i]; } return hash >>> 0; } /** * Calculate a 32 bit FNV-1a hash */ function fnv(input) { let hash = 0x811c9dc5; for (let i = 0; i < input.length; i++) { hash ^= input[i]; hash += (hash << 1) + (hash << 4) + (hash << 7) + (hash << 8) + (hash << 24); } return hash >>> 0; } /** * Calculate a 32 bit DJB hash. */ function djb(input) { let hash = 5381; for (let i = 0; i < input.length; i++) { hash = (hash << 5) + hash + input[i]; } return hash >>> 0; } /** * Calculate a 32 bit Murmur3 hash. */ function murmur3(key) { let seed = arguments.length <= 1 || arguments[1] === undefined ? 0 : arguments[1]; let h1b, k1; const remainder = key.length & 3; // key.length % 4 const bytes = key.length - remainder; let h1 = seed; let c1 = 0xcc9e2d51; let c2 = 0x1b873593; let i = 0; while (i < bytes) { k1 = key[i] & 0xff | (key[++i] & 0xff) << 8 | (key[++i] & 0xff) << 16 | (key[++i] & 0xff) << 24; ++i; k1 = (k1 & 0xffff) * c1 + (((k1 >>> 16) * c1 & 0xffff) << 16) & 0xffffffff; k1 = k1 << 15 | k1 >>> 17; k1 = (k1 & 0xffff) * c2 + (((k1 >>> 16) * c2 & 0xffff) << 16) & 0xffffffff; h1 ^= k1; h1 = h1 << 13 | h1 >>> 19; h1b = (h1 & 0xffff) * 5 + (((h1 >>> 16) * 5 & 0xffff) << 16) & 0xffffffff; h1 = (h1b & 0xffff) + 0x6b64 + (((h1b >>> 16) + 0xe654 & 0xffff) << 16); } k1 = 0; switch (remainder) { case 3: k1 ^= (key[i + 2] & 0xff) << 16; case 2: k1 ^= (key[i + 1] & 0xff) << 8; case 1: k1 ^= key[i] & 0xff; k1 = (k1 & 0xffff) * c1 + (((k1 >>> 16) * c1 & 0xffff) << 16) & 0xffffffff; k1 = k1 << 15 | k1 >>> 17; k1 = (k1 & 0xffff) * c2 + (((k1 >>> 16) * c2 & 0xffff) << 16) & 0xffffffff; h1 ^= k1; } h1 ^= key.length; h1 ^= h1 >>> 16; h1 = (h1 & 0xffff) * 0x85ebca6b + (((h1 >>> 16) * 0x85ebca6b & 0xffff) << 16) & 0xffffffff; h1 ^= h1 >>> 13; h1 = (h1 & 0xffff) * 0xc2b2ae35 + (((h1 >>> 16) * 0xc2b2ae35 & 0xffff) << 16) & 0xffffffff; h1 ^= h1 >>> 16; return h1 >>> 0; }
